Amanda is a member of Neal Gerber Eisenberg’s Private Wealth Services practice group, where she focuses her practice on estate, tax, charitable and corporate planning for high-net-worth individuals and families, closely-held businesses, private foundations and family offices. She is highly experienced in drafting complex wills and trusts for clients, and has successfully represented trustees and trust beneficiaries in fiduciary litigation.Amanda advises clients on all tax and legal matters regarding charitable and planned giving, including private foundations and donor-advised funds. She is a trusted private tax attorney and is adept in preparing gift and estate tax returns.She is a member of the Chicago Estate Planning Council and Chicago Bar Association, and the Former Chair of the YLS Estate Planning Committee. Additionally, she is a board member of Emerge of the Museum of Contemporary Art. Amanda has engaged in numerous speaking presentations for organizations such as the Chicago Bar Association’s Trust Law Committee and Estate Planning Committee.
